Craig Constable's Office, Missouri
End of Watch Saturday, July 30, 1887
Add to My HeroesAnthony DeLong
Constable Anthony DeLong succumbed to gunshot wounds received two days earlier as he and others were in a gun battle with a gang of desperadoes responsible for committing all kinds of crimes all over the state. Constable Delong's killer was captured in DeWitt several days later. He was tried and acquitted.
